Output e98f6987db3528570c9635a7515f071c1f9f7b629fbc81b52d3da576c2ffcf66:0

value
180522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be7027d3d825ce5d887922d1ddd234750608c469 OP_EQUAL
address
3K3xfhQw2j6hq8WnmfXpKHRtJNrvEF2djL
transaction
e98f6987db3528570c9635a7515f071c1f9f7b629fbc81b52d3da576c2ffcf66
confirmations
251175
spent
true